Where is the engine number of BMW X3 located?

The engine number of BMW X3 is located at the lower left side of the engine, and it is also on the vehicle nameplate, which is placed at the door opening area of the front passenger seat. Generally, the engine number of a car can be found in: 1. The vehicle registration certificate; 2. Engraved on the engine block, open the hood to check the marking on the engine block. BMW X3 is an SUV model with a length, width, and height of 4648mm, 1881mm, and 1661mm respectively, and a wheelbase of 2810mm. The new BMW X3 has a length, width, and height of 4717mm, 1891mm, and 1689mm respectively, and a wheelbase of 2864mm. The new BMW X3 has added front seat heating, removed the in-car CD, and the 9-speaker audio system is no longer optional. The xDrive28i series has added a sensor-activated tailgate, front seat heating, and a 16-speaker audio system. The xDrive30i has added ACC adaptive cruise control, a 16-speaker audio system, and other configurations. In terms of safety features, the new BMW X3 comes standard with road traffic sign recognition, and the xDrive30i also adds lane change assist and lane departure warning.

The engine number of the BMW X3 is usually located on the front of the engine block, near the pulley or water pump. Just open the hood and look down carefully to spot it. I find this quite interesting because BMW designed it to simplify the identification process by placing it in a very visible location, saving users the trouble of searching around. I've checked several X3 models myself, and the position is consistently fixed on a metal tag at the front of the engine. However, note that the engine number is directly engraved and might be covered by oil or dirt—just wipe it with a cloth to make it clear. By the way, it matches the VIN number, and getting it wrong could affect vehicle registration procedures, so it's best to have a technician verify it during maintenance to avoid issues during traffic police checks. What is the original engine oil specification for Toyota Corolla?

The official Toyota Corolla manual recommends engine oil specifications of 0W-20, 5W-20, and 5W-30. Any oil meeting these three specifications can be used. Below is relevant information about Corolla engine oil usage: 1. The number before the "W" in Corolla engine oil indicates the oil's viscosity at low temperatures. A smaller number means better low-temperature fluidity, providing superior engine protection during cold starts. 2. The number after "W" represents the oil's viscosity at 100°C, with higher numbers indicating higher viscosity. Based on this characteristic: - 0W oil is suitable for winter use in northeastern China, Inner Mongolia, and Xinjiang - In southern regions like Guangdong and Hainan, 5W or 10W oil is sufficient (0W isn't strictly necessary) - The 20, 30, or 40 grade should be selected according to the engine's performance requirements.

What are the body dimensions of the Jinbei 750?

The Jinbei 750 has a length of 4560 mm, a width of 1790 mm, and a height of 1795 mm, with a wheelbase of 2725 mm. The Jinbei 750 is equipped with the following two naturally aspirated engines: 1. A 1.5-liter naturally aspirated engine producing 112 horsepower and 147 Nm of maximum torque. This engine reaches its maximum power at 5800 rpm and its maximum torque between 4000 and 4500 rpm. It features multi-point fuel injection technology and uses an aluminum alloy cylinder head and block. This engine is paired with a 5-speed manual transmission. 2. A 1.6-liter naturally aspirated engine producing 117 horsepower and 160 Nm of maximum torque. This engine reaches its maximum power at 5800 rpm and its maximum torque between 3800 and 4400 rpm. It also features multi-point fuel injection technology and uses an aluminum alloy cylinder head and block. This engine is also paired with a 5-speed manual transmission.

How to Fold Down the Rear Seats of the Tiguan L?

Here are the steps to fold down the rear seats of the Tiguan L: 1. Locate the latches that secure the rear seats, which are positioned on both sides of the seats. 2. Use both hands to simultaneously grip the two latches and pull them forward with force. 3. This will allow the seats to fold down. Once folded, remember to remove the seatbelt buckle at the connection point of the seats. Below is some relevant information about the rear seats: 1. The rear seats feature a one-piece fold-down design, meaning the entire backrest can be folded down to create more space when needed. However, when the rear seats are folded down, they cannot accommodate passengers. 2. The rear seats also offer a split-folding function, allowing the backrest to be folded down in specific proportions. Compared to the one-piece fold-down design, the split-folding feature provides greater flexibility, enabling you to fold down only half of the backrest to accommodate larger items while the remaining portion can still be used for seating. Different vehicle models may have varying fold-down proportions.
